The value of `4/(tan^2 60^@)+1/(cos^2 30^@)-sin^2 90^@` is equal to ……….

Text Solution

AI Generated Solution

The correct Answer is:
To solve the expression \( \frac{4}{\tan^2 60^\circ} + \frac{1}{\cos^2 30^\circ} - \sin^2 90^\circ \), we will follow these steps: ### Step 1: Calculate \( \tan^2 60^\circ \) We know that: \[ \tan 60^\circ = \sqrt{3} \] Thus, \[ \tan^2 60^\circ = (\sqrt{3})^2 = 3 \] ### Step 2: Substitute \( \tan^2 60^\circ \) into the expression Now, we substitute this value into the expression: \[ \frac{4}{\tan^2 60^\circ} = \frac{4}{3} \] ### Step 3: Calculate \( \cos^2 30^\circ \) We know that: \[ \cos 30^\circ = \frac{\sqrt{3}}{2} \] Thus, \[ \cos^2 30^\circ = \left(\frac{\sqrt{3}}{2}\right)^2 = \frac{3}{4} \] ### Step 4: Substitute \( \cos^2 30^\circ \) into the expression Now, we substitute this value into the expression: \[ \frac{1}{\cos^2 30^\circ} = \frac{1}{\frac{3}{4}} = \frac{4}{3} \] ### Step 5: Calculate \( \sin^2 90^\circ \) We know that: \[ \sin 90^\circ = 1 \] Thus, \[ \sin^2 90^\circ = 1^2 = 1 \] ### Step 6: Substitute \( \sin^2 90^\circ \) into the expression Now, we substitute this value into the expression: \[ -\sin^2 90^\circ = -1 \] ### Step 7: Combine all parts of the expression Now we combine all the parts: \[ \frac{4}{3} + \frac{4}{3} - 1 \] ### Step 8: Simplify the expression Combine the fractions: \[ \frac{4}{3} + \frac{4}{3} = \frac{8}{3} \] Then subtract 1 (which is \(\frac{3}{3}\)): \[ \frac{8}{3} - \frac{3}{3} = \frac{5}{3} \] ### Final Answer Thus, the value of the expression is: \[ \frac{5}{3} \] ---
